Subject: [PATCH 5.4 33/43] bnxt_en: Protect bnxt_set_eee() and bnxt_set_pauseparam() with mutex.

From: Michael Chan <michael.chan@broadcom.com>
[ Upstream commit a53906908148d64423398a62c4435efb0d09652c ]
All changes related to bp->link_info require the protection of the
link_lock mutex. It's not sufficient to rely just on RTNL.

---
dr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nxt/bnxt_ethtool.c | 31 ++++++++++++++--------
1 file changed, 20 insertions(+), 11 deletions(-)
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nxt/bnxt_ethtool.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/bnxt/bnxt_ethtool.c
@@ -1665,9 +1665,12 @@ static int bnxt_set_pauseparam(struct ne
if (!BNXT_SINGLE_PF(bp))
return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+ mutex_lock(&bp->link_lock);
if (epause->autoneg) {
- if (!(link_info->autoneg & BNXT_AUTONEG_SPEED))
- return -EINVAL;
+ if (!(link_info->autoneg & BNXT_AUTONEG_SPEED)) {
+ rc = -EINVAL;
+ goto pause_exit;
+ }
link_info->autoneg |= BNXT_AUTONEG_FLOW_CTRL;
if (bp->hwrm_spec_code >= 0x10201)
@@ -1688,11 +1691,11 @@ static int bnxt_set_pauseparam(struct ne
if (epause->tx_pause)
link_info->req_flow_ctrl |= BNXT_LINK_PAUSE_TX;
- if (netif_running(dev)) {
- mutex_lock(&bp->link_lock);
+ if (netif_running(dev))
rc = bnxt_hwrm_set_pause(bp);
- mutex_unlock(&bp->link_lock);
- }
+
+pause_exit:
+ mutex_unlock(&bp->link_lock);
return rc;
}
@@ -2397,8 +2400,7 @@ static int bnxt_set_eee(struct net_devic
struct bnxt *bp = netdev_priv(dev);
struct ethtool_eee *eee = &bp->eee;
struct bnxt_link_info *link_info = &bp->link_info;
- u32 advertising =
- _bnxt_fw_to_ethtool_adv_spds(link_info->advertising, 0);
+ u32 advertising;
int rc = 0;
if (!BNXT_SINGLE_PF(bp))
@@ -2407,19 +2409,23 @@ static int bnxt_set_eee(struct net_devic
if (!(bp->flags & BNXT_FLAG_EEE_CAP))
return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+ mutex_lock(&bp->link_lock);
+ advertising = _bnxt_fw_to_ethtool_adv_spds(link_info->advertising, 0);
if (!edata->eee_enabled)
goto eee_ok;
if (!(link_info->autoneg & BNXT_AUTONEG_SPEED)) {
netdev_warn(dev, "EEE requires autoneg\n");
- return -EINVAL;
+ rc = -EINVAL;
+ goto eee_exit;
}
if (edata->tx_lpi_enabled) {
if (bp->lpi_tmr_hi && (edata->tx_lpi_timer > bp->lpi_tmr_hi ||
edata->tx_lpi_timer < bp->lpi_tmr_lo)) {
netdev_warn(dev, "Valid LPI timer range is %d and %d microsecs\n",
bp->lpi_tmr_lo, bp->lpi_tmr_hi);
- return -EINVAL;
+ rc = -EINVAL;
+ goto eee_exit;
} else if (!bp->lpi_tmr_hi) {
edata->tx_lpi_timer = eee->tx_lpi_timer;
}
@@ -2429,7 +2435,8 @@ static int bnxt_set_eee(struct net_devic
} else if (edata->advertised & ~advertising) {
netdev_warn(dev, "EEE advertised %x must be a subset of autoneg advertised speeds %x\n",
edata->advertised, advertising);
- return -EINVAL;
+ rc = -EINVAL;
+ goto eee_exit;
}
eee->advertised = edata->advertised;
@@ -2441,6 +2448,8 @@ eee_ok:
if (netif_running(dev))
rc = bnxt_hwrm_set_link_setting(bp, false, true);
+eee_exit:
+ mutex_unlock(&bp->link_lock);
return rc;
}
